a. What dessert do you want?
¿Qué postre quiere? - No lo sé. Aún no me decido.What dessert do you want? - I don't know. I haven't decided yet.
b. What dessert would you like?
¿Qué postre quiere? - Quiero el pay de calabaza, por favor.What dessert would you like?- I'd like the pumpkin pie, please.
a. What dessert does he want?
¿Qué postre quiere? - Seguro quiere un helado.What dessert does he want? - I'm sure he wants ice cream.
b. What dessert does she want?
¿Qué postre quiere? - Dijo que le encantaría comer pastel de chocolate.What dessert does she want? - She said she'd love to have some chocolate cake.
c. What dessert would he like?
¿Qué postre quiere? - No lo sé. ¿Por qué no le preguntas?What dessert would he like? - I don't know. Why don't you ask him?
d. What dessert would she like?
¿Qué postre quiere? - Estoy seguro que le encantaría un pay de manzana.What dessert would she like? - I'm sure she'd love an apple pie.
